Visit Moc Chau you should not skeep Ang village. Because you will have the …The American Folk Art Museum was initially opened in 1963 on West 53rd Street in Midtown Manhattan. However, since 2011, it has been located on Columbus Avenue at Lincoln Square in the Upper West Side district of Manhattan. The Museum is …The field of American folk art was first defined at the turn of the twentieth century by collectors, professional artists, critics, dealers, and curators whose search for an authentic American art seemed to be finally answered in works that presented a nuanced picture of national identity, faith, progress, ingenuity, community, and individuality.The Museum notes with profound sadness the passing of Gerard C. Wertkin, a scholar, curator, and attorney who was Director of the American Folk Art Museum for nearly 15 years. Initially hired in 1981 as Assistant Director of the Museum, Wertkin ascended to the role of Director in 1991 where he remained until his retirement in 2004.Left: Dindga McCannon, Mary Lou Williams–Jazz Pianist, United States, 2017, Mixed media, 31 x 44 in. As one of … American Folk Art Museum, art museum in Manhattan, New York, dedicated to the collection, exhibition, and study of works created by self-taught American artists and artisans. The collection includes pieces from the 17th to 21st century, with such objects as textiles, paintings, sculptures, drawings, and photographs.
